This replaces PR #51 #51 which was from the wrong branch in this fork. This also adds additional notes regarding enabling proxying to upstream indexes.
The original comment for PR 51:
In installing djangopypi for the first time I found that the README was not sufficiently complete for new users. Whilst I could see what was required get get package upload and download working, it could slow down others or cause them to give up.
I have therefore added to the README file in a way that I think helps.
